Best of Show: Delage D8S Wins at Pebble Beach 2010

The Judges have decided. The Best of Show at this year’s Pebble Beach Concours d’Elegance is a 1933 Delage D8S De Villars Roadster, owned by The Patterson Collection in Louisville, Kentucky.

“There are so many things about this car that are special,” said owner Jim Patterson, “We've won at a lot of concours, but never here. This win at Pebble is the ultimate. This is the one win that really matters.” The white, streamlined 1933 Delage with coachwork from De Villars beat competitors from 33 states and 14 countries to become the 60th annual Best of Show winner, at California’s Monterey Peninsula on Sunday 15 August. “This Delage has a short wheelbase that makes it look more rakish, but it still has a long and elegant look,” added Concours Chairman Sandra Button, explaining the judges’ decision. “It did 110mph in its day; it could race and was stunningly beautiful. This car could do it all; it embodied style, speed and comfort.”
